When I modify /etc/passwd, I still can't telnet into my box.The NSLU2 keeps multiple copies of /etc/passwd. You may also need to change the copies in /usr/local and /share/*/conf/.
1: /share/hdd/conf/usr/local/passwd
/share/hdd/conf/passwd
/share/flash/conf/passwd
/share/flash/conf/usr/local/passwd
2: /share/hdd/conf/etc/passwd -> /share/hdd/conf/passwd
/share/flash/conf/etc/passwd -> /share/hdd/conf/passwd
3: /usr/local/etc/passwd
Marked with 1 are the locations you should check and edit. Marked with 2 are links only. |
